Home Health provides care to patients at home-where they receive support from trained medical professionals, family, friends, plus the comfort of familiar surroundings. Regardless of age, everyone appreciates the comfort and convenience of recovery in their home as an alternative to hospitalization or a nursing home. Home healthcare may also mean earlier discharge from the hospital, and lower healthcare costs. Hospice is a special kind of care for people with life-limiting illnesses. Hospice is not a place, it is an all-encompassing approach to the care provided in the comfort of your home or where you call home.
